Entry Description

Magazzino Italian Art is a private initiative conceived by Nancy Olnick and Giorgio Spanu to house their collection of postwar Italian Art. The commission consisted in a full renovation of an existing 11,000 square-foot building and an additional 14,000 square feet of new construction. The starting approach was simple: the existing L-shaped building could be completed into a rectangle with a central courtyard.This allowed us to propose an independent structure parallel to the longer part of the existing building estableshing a dialogue between the new and existing building.
